WebThe current case highlights a unilateral atypical formation of brachial plexus, the so called prefix, in which the C4 root contributed a large branch to the superior trunk and further anastomosis with the inferior trunk. Thus, the prefix or high brachial plexus consisted of a superior and inferior trunk and one anterior cord. Arising from the C5-T1 ventral rami of the spinal cord, the brachial plexus is divided anatomically into roots, trunks, divisions and cords (Figure 1). The inferior trunk lies on rib I posterior to the subclavian artery; the middle and superior trunks are more superior in position. Terminal branches begin in the axilla. Are formed by the ventral rami of spinal nerves C5-C8 and T1. The 5th and 6th cervical roots join to form the upper trunk. The 7th cervical root forms the middle trunk. The 8th cervical and 1st thoracic roots join to ... WebAt the root of the neck, the brachial plexus is formed in the posterior triangle of the neck by the union of the anterior rami of the fifth, sixth, seventh, and eighth cervical and the first thoracic spinal nerves. The plexus can be divided into roots, trunks, ##### divisions, and cords.
